Commissioners move to tighten credit-card policy, assign staff to rewrite handbook language

Banner County Board of Commissioners · January 21, 2026

Summary

After extended discussion, the board instructed staff to revise the county credit-card policy and employee-handbook language to limit cardholders, ban meals on cards (to be reimbursed), allow office supplies/tools and require receipts; Casey was assigned to prepare a word-ready draft for the next meeting.

Banner County commissioners spent a lengthy portion of the Jan. 20 meeting reviewing the countys credit-card authorization and proposed handbook changes.
